Exposing The Explants For laser-RAY and its impact on some vegetative Characteristics and biochemical of date palm Phoenix Dactylifera L. cultivation in vitro

Abstract

This study was conducted in date palm research center for the period from June 2013 until June 2014 in aim recognize the effect of exposure the explants of date palm of lasers at different distances and different periods of time in formation of buds and numbers as well as in some the vegetative characteristics and biochemical .the explants treated once a week for 10 weeks as the explants exposure for a period (0,25.50)second and (5 and 10)cm from the source of the laser the results showed1-Led exposure of explants treatments for laser to increase the number of vegetative buds formed as the observed rise the number of buds at distance 5 cm and for period exposing 25 second as it gave 6.22 buds compared with the other treatments and the control treatment .also the same treatment gave less period of time to formed the buds as 80.3 days with the significant difference compared with control treatment .2- The results showed the exposure of explants for laser led to reduce in the content of phenol compounds ,noting lower content at distance 5 cm and for period exposing 25 second reached 80.1% with the significant difference compared with control treatment .3- Exposure of explants for laser led to increase of carbohydrate content material as given the treatment at distance 5 cm and for period exposing 25 second highcontent of carbohydrate as well as the same treatment led to increase the content of total protein with the significant difference compared with control treatment .4- This study showed that exposure of the explants of laser-ray has led to increase of total content of chlorophyll as the observed the treatment at a distance 5 cm and period 25 second gave the high content of total chlorophyll reached 0.188% compared with the control treatment.
